Quotes Logo Montmartre District Walking Tour in Paris lets guests explore the heart of Parisian charm. This 2-hour walking tour takes guests through the lovely streets of Montmartre. Guests will see where famous artists like Vincent Van Gogh and Pablo Picasso once lived and worked. This part of Paris has cafes, bars, and artists that make it special.

During the tour, guests will walk past the Moulin Rouge, known for its exciting shows. The tour also stops at Place du Tertre, where many artists show and sell their work. Other must-see spots include Picasso's Studio, Van Gogh's House, the fun Lapin Agile cabaret, and the beautiful Basilica Sacré-Cœur. Plus, guests will see Place Dalida, the Montmartre Vineyard, Café des Deux Moulins (from the movie *Amélie*), La Maison Rose, and the red-light district.

A local guide leads the tour, sharing stories about the area's history and culture. Please note that food, drinks, and hotel pick-up are not included. This tour gives a close-up look at Montmartre’s unique spirit. This tour has excellent quality based on Viator reviews. Quotes Logo

The Journey

1

Moulin Rouge

Step into the dazzling world of the Moulin Rouge, the iconic cabaret that epitomizes Parisian nightlife. Witness the spectacle of the Féerie show, a whirlwind of feathers, sequins, and extravagant performances that have captivated audiences for over a century. Learn about the Moulin Rouge's scandalous beginnings, its rise to fame, and its enduring legacy as a symbol of Parisian joie de vivre. It's more than a show; it's an immersion into the heart of bohemian Paris.

2

Place du Tertre

Immerse yourself in the artistic heart of Montmartre at Place du Tertre, a vibrant square where artists create and display their works. Watch portraitists, painters, and caricaturists capture the essence of Paris and its visitors. Feel the energy of this historic square, once a gathering place for legendary artists like Picasso and Van Gogh. Purchase a unique souvenir or simply soak in the atmosphere of creativity that permeates every corner.

3

Picasso's Studio & Van Gogh's House

Walk in the footsteps of artistic giants as you explore Picasso's former studio and Van Gogh's house in Montmartre. Discover the humble abodes where these masters honed their craft and drew inspiration from the vibrant Parisian atmosphere. Hear tales of other renowned artists, from Dali to Monet, who also found solace and inspiration in this bohemian haven. Understand why Montmartre became a crucible for artistic innovation, shaping the course of modern art.

4

Lapin Agile

Experience the charm of Lapin Agile, the oldest cabaret in Montmartre, a place steeped in artistic history. Imagine Picasso exchanging his paintings for food within these very walls! Feel the echoes of laughter, music, and artistic camaraderie that have resonated through this intimate space for generations. Step back in time and savor the authentic bohemian spirit of Montmartre in this legendary haunt.

5

Basilica Sacré-Cœur

Ascend to the Basilica Sacré-Cœur, a breathtaking Roman Catholic church perched atop Montmartre, offering unparalleled panoramic views of Paris. Marvel at the basilica's stunning architecture, a fusion of Romanesque and Byzantine styles. Discover the history behind its construction, a symbol of national penance following the Franco-Prussian War. Take in the awe-inspiring beauty of Paris spread out before you, a moment of serenity and reflection high above the bustling city.

6

Place Dalida

Pay homage to a Parisian icon at Place Dalida, a charming square dedicated to the legendary singer and actress Dalida. Discover the story of this beloved figure, known for her powerful voice and glamorous persona. Reflect on her impact on French culture and her enduring status as a symbol of LGBTQ+ pride. This quiet corner of Montmartre offers a poignant reminder of the stars that shine brightest in the City of Lights.

7

Montmartre Vineyard

Discover a hidden gem in the heart of Paris at the Montmartre Vineyard, the city's last authentic vineyard. Stroll through the rows of vines, a testament to Montmartre's agricultural past. Learn about the unique grape varietals grown here and the traditions of winemaking that continue to thrive. Sample the local wine (seasonal availability) and savor a taste of Parisian terroir, a unique experience that blends urban life with rural charm.

8

Café des Deux Moulins

Step into the whimsical world of Amélie at the Café des Deux Moulins, the charming café featured in the beloved French film. Relive iconic scenes from the movie and soak in the café's quirky atmosphere. Enjoy a traditional French coffee or pastry and immerse yourself in the ambiance that captured the hearts of moviegoers worldwide. It's a perfect spot for film buffs and those seeking a touch of Parisian magic.

9

La Maison Rose

Capture the quintessential Montmartre scene at La Maison Rose (The Pink House), a picturesque restaurant with a rich artistic history. Admire its charming facade, a favorite subject of photographers and painters alike. Imagine Picasso and other artists frequenting this very spot, sharing ideas and inspiration. This iconic landmark embodies the artistic spirit and timeless beauty of Montmartre.

10

Paris' Red Light District

Explore the Pigalle district, Paris' famed Red Light District, home to the Moulin Rouge and a vibrant nightlife scene. Witness the evolution of this historic neighborhood, from its bohemian roots to its modern-day entertainment venues. While known for its risqué reputation, Pigalle also offers a glimpse into a different side of Parisian culture, with its bustling streets, lively bars, and unique atmosphere. (Note: exercise discretion and be aware of your surroundings.)

Know Before You Go

This walking tour of Montmartre includes a local guide who will show guests around the area. It does not include food and drinks, or hotel pick-up and drop-off. Guests will meet their guide at a set location and walk through the streets of Montmartre to see the sights.

Hot Tip

Wear comfy shoes because you'll walk a lot! Some streets are steep. Also, bring a camera to take photos of the pretty streets and sights.
